Customer Relationship Management (CRM) Systems

 

 

Description

Customer relationship management software allows users to keep track of their customers, donors or members and target mailings or other services to them.  This can also be used to track grantees. 

 

Uses and Potential Benefits

Allows organizations to integrate contacts data that had been housed in separte data sets and to track a wide range of information regarding the contacts.  Example: with a CRM system, a foundation could track it's grantees, along with people who attended foundation events, and then note which grantees attended events.
